The Space Between Hope & Despair
The space between hope and despair
isn't even thin enough to fit air
only one thing can dwell there
it is precious and rare
Its something that we share
and many try to just ensnare
I’ve seen it like a crystal stair
just floating over behind the chair
it bigger than a bugle blast
fleet as the time that past
unbreakable one the die is cast
unshakeable to the very last
when in a tight room it won't feel overcrowded
experiencing it will make you never doubt it
even when the sun is clouded
the veil is shrouded
or
the time is outed
U scream and shout it
I cannot do without it
I feel all about it
I am turn'd out by it.
I wanna drape it in my skin
let the sun shine in
inward outwardly
redouble it bountifully
be ever so lightly
ever so slightly
lifted
blessed an gifted
miracles are born every day
and indeed I do pray
you know what I mean to say
yes it is true I love you too
the space between hope and despair
isn't even thin enough to fit air
only one thing can dwell there
it is precious and rare
its something that we share
many try to just ensnare
I’ve seen it like a crystal stair
just floating over behind the chair
